To establish effective school discipline policies educators must understand the nature of and reasons for misbehavior social and legal attitudes toward the schools disciplinary function acceptable responses to disciplinary problems and the components of effective policies.

Self-discipline is seen in socially and morally responsible behavior that is motivated primarily by intrinsic factors not solely by the anticipation of external rewards or fear of punishment.
